Benefits of Small House Plans
There are several advantages to choosing a house plan under 1500 square feet:
- Reduced Construction Costs: Smaller homes require fewer materials and labor, resulting in lower construction expenses.
- Lower Energy Bills: Smaller homes require less energy to heat and cool, leading to reduced utility costs.
- Less Maintenance: Smaller homes have fewer rooms and a smaller exterior, requiring less time and effort to maintain.
- Increased Efficiency: Compact floor plans promote efficient use of space, minimizing wasted areas.
- Environmental Sustainability: Smaller homes have a smaller carbon footprint, contributing to environmental conservation.
Common Features of Small House Plans
While designs vary, certain features are common in house plans under 1500 square feet:
- Open Floor Plans: Open living areas create a sense of spaciousness and allow for multiple uses of a single room.
- Compact Bedrooms: Bedrooms are typically smaller in size, with ample storage space provided through closets and built-ins.
- Efficient Bathrooms: Bathrooms are streamlined, with space-saving fixtures and layouts.
- Multifunctional Spaces: Rooms can serve multiple purposes, such as a guest room that doubles as an office.
- Outdoor Living Spaces: Patios or decks extend the living area outdoors, providing additional space for entertaining or relaxation.
Popular House Plan Styles
Small house plans come in a variety of architectural styles:
- Craftsman: Known for its natural materials, wide porches, and exposed beams.
- Ranch: Single-story, sprawling homes with open floor plans and attached garages.
- Contemporary: Clean lines, large windows, and open layouts define contemporary homes.
- Farmhouse: Warm and inviting homes with farmhouse sinks, shiplap walls, and cozy fireplaces.
- Traditional: Classic and symmetrical homes with gabled roofs, dormer windows, and charming details.
